Pricing

Willow Creek of Sheridan offers competitive pricing for its accommodations compared to both Sheridan County and the broader state of Wyoming. For a studio apartment, residents will find the monthly cost at Willow Creek is $3,275, which is notably lower than the county average of $3,578 and slightly above the state average of $3,322. Similarly, for a one-bedroom unit, the rate at Willow Creek stands at $3,400, offering an attractive alternative to the higher county price of $4,398 while remaining below Wyoming's average of $3,890. This positioning underscores Willow Creek's commitment to providing quality living options that are financially accessible within their regional context.

Room TypeWillow Creek of SheridanSheridan CountyWyoming
Studio$3,275$3,578$3,322
1 Bedroom$3,400$4,398$3,890
